How Our Subfloor Water Extraction Process Works
With subfloor water extraction, a proper process is crucial to prevent further damage and ensure a successful repair. Our team uses specialized equipment and techniques to remove standing water, dry the subfloor, and restore your home to its original condition.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our technicians will conduct a thorough inspection to identify the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ll assess the condition of your subfloor, walls, and flooring to find out the best course of action.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our equipment is designed to quickly and efficiently remove standing water from your subfloor. We’ll use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to extract as much water as possible.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our technicians will use specialized equipment to dry your subfloor and surrounding areas. We’ll monitor the moisture levels to ensure that your home is completely dry before proceeding.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Our team will repair and restore your subfloor, walls, and flooring to their original condition. We’ll use high-quality materials and techniques to ensure a durable and long-lasting repair.
